Florida-based company that deals with cancer diagnostics Oncosure announced on Wednesday that it has launched its Rapid Cancer Screening Test, making early detection accessible to everyone.
It is claimed that the Oncosure test can screen for all types of cancer with one blood sample and that it provides a method to detect cancer at its earliest stages, even as early as stage -1 and delivers accurate, definitive results within hours. The company says that it also helps in monitoring ongoing cancer treatments, helping assess whether therapies are effective.
Jason Andrews, Oncosure vice president, said, 'One blood draw, all cancers--this is the future of cancer screening. Cancer doesn't wait for symptoms, and neither should you. Our test empowers everyone to screen for any type of cancer with a single, non-invasive test.'
